Fans React as Viral Video Shows Singer Being Overrun by Crowd at Dehradun Show
A video from Jasmine Sandlas' Dehradun performance has gone viral, showing the singer allegedly mobbed and touched inappropriately, prompting calls for tighter security at live events.
When Jasmine Sandlas took the stage in Dehradun last weekend, she was expecting a night of music and fan‑fare. What unfolded, however, quickly turned into a chaotic scene that has now flooded social media.
The footage, shared widely on Twitter and Instagram, shows the Punjabi‑pop star stepping down from the platform to greet fans, accept roses and hand out smiles. Within seconds, a handful of people in the front row drift closer, brushing against her and, according to many viewers, touching her in an unwelcome manner.
Sandlas can be heard asking the crowd to give her a little space, while members of her crew repeatedly wave security staff forward. The tension builds until, finally, a security guard gently escorts her back to the stage.
Online reactions were swift and largely condemnatory. One user wrote, “It’s not ‘the crowd’ in general – it only takes a few to cross the line, and they must be held accountable.” Another added, “Artists, especially women, deserve respect when they try to connect with fans.” The consensus? Better crowd‑control measures are a must.
As of now, Jasmine Sandlas has not issued an official statement about the incident. Her team, however, has been urged to review security protocols for future concerts, a sentiment echoed by fans across the country.
Beyond the controversy, it’s worth remembering why Sandlas draws such passionate crowds. She’s the voice behind hits like “Yaar Na Miley,” “Taras,” and the recent chart‑buster “Shararat” from the film Dhurandhar. Her energetic performances and distinct vocal texture have earned her a dedicated following both in India and abroad.
